Warning Signs You Need Restaurant Water Damage Restoration

Beware of these common warning signs that show you need Restaurant Water Damage Restoration.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ore musty odors that won’t go away, they can be a sign of hidden water dam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Musty odors can be a sign of hidden water damage, and they can be a health hazard.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your restaurant, it’s essential to investigate further. Look for signs of water damage and address the issue quickly.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ice that your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s essential to investigate further. Check for water damage and address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age. If you notice water stains, it’s essential to investigate further. Check for water damage and address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Restaurant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water damage in a small area Yes No DIY can be effective for minor water damage in small areas.
Water damage in a large area or multiple areas No Yes Water damage in large areas or multiple areas needs professional equipment and expertise.
Water damage with vis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Mold and mildew can be a health hazard, and professional equipment is needed to safely remove them.
Water damage with electrical or plumbing issues No Yes Electrical or plumbing issues can be hazardous and need professional expertise to address.
Water damage with structural damage to walls or ceilings No Yes Structural damage needs professional expertise to ensure the structure is safe and secure.
Water damage with a strong musty odor No Yes A strong musty odor can show hidden water damage and needs professional equipment to safely remove.
